Preferred Label : Antibody-Dependent Enhancement of Infection;

NCIt synonyms : Antibody-Dependent Enhancement;

NCIt definition : A phenomenon that occurs when antibodies present in the body from a primary infection bind to an infecting viral particle during a subsequent infection with a different serotype. The antibodies from the primary infection cannot neutralize the virus. Instead, the Ab-virus complexes attach to Fc receptors on circulating monocytes. The antibodies then facilitate more efficient viral infection of monocytes. The outcome is an increase in the overall replication of the virus and a higher risk of disease that is more severe than the initial infection.;
